Cross-Checking the Bears
- The Missouri State women's cross country team will head to Bradley for the first time this season for the Bradley Pink Classic on Friday afternoon.
- The race will feature two women's races that are 6-kilometers each. The white race will begin at 2:15 p.m. and the red race at 3:45 p.m. The second race of the day will be limited to nine athletes per team. The race will be broadcast on ESPN+.
- The Classic will feature seven other MVC schools: Bradley, Drake, Illinois State, UIC, Indiana State, Northern Iowa and Southern Illinois.
- Sixteen Bears will be representing Missouri State on the course.
- This won't be MoState's only trip to Bradley this year. The team will return to Peoria on Nov. 15 for the NCAA Midwest Regional.
- The last time out the Bears finished 28th out of 38 teams at the Gans Creek Invitational at Missouri in a field that included 12 Power Four teams, including four that competed for the 2023 NCAA title.
- Sophomore Tabitha Fox led the Bears across the line for the first time in her career with a time of 21:45.5 and a 132nd-place finish out of 329 runners.
